President Emanuel Makron stated that he would hold talks with allies how French nuclear weapons can protect Europe, as the continent is making efforts to protect the comica Russia.

On Wednesday, Macron answered Friedrich Merz, a German Chancellor who expected German Chancellor, whether France and the United Kingdom will be ready for a “nuclear exchange.” If the US became a less reliable partner.

“Our nuclear restraint protects us. It is complete, sovereign and completely French, “Makron said. “However, in response to the historical call of the future German Chancellor, I decided to open strategic discussions through our restraint on the protection of our European continental allies.”

The French nuclear arsenal is much smaller than the US equivalent, and therefore will not be able to provide the same level of European security as America.

France is unlikely to suggest that the United States agrees with its nuclear exchange, which is an important part of NATO restraint.

The agreement allows several European members of NATO, such as Germany and Italy, to host US nuclear weapons on their land and maintain combat planes capable of wearing them.

However, Macron protects for a stronger Europe for a long time that does not rely on US security.

“The future of Europe should not be decided in Washington or Moscow,” he said. “I want to believe that the United States will stay with us. But we must be ready, if it weren’t for the case. “

Makron said that European military budgets will have to climb to meet new challenges, which makes it difficult to make public expenditures.

“These will be new investments that require mobilization of private funding, as well as public funding without increasing taxes,” he added. “It will need to be reforms, elections and courage.”
